Presentation Abstract

Audio and video (AV) provides teachers and students with opportunities to present information, communicate, and support in online and blended classroom. The use of AV tools can foster a sense of presence, increase engagement, and improve learning outcomes. In this workshop, participants will learn how to create and use audio and video for the classroom using various FREE tools.
